3
Arcadia Round Barn
Historical landmark
A round, red 1898 barn, now a historic roadside attraction & popular Route 66 pit stop.

6
Pops 66
American restaurant
Landmark diner & gas station with hundreds of sodas, a shop & a 66-ft.-tall soda bottle out front.
